I actually wondered if they were going to sign him to the PS. It seemed weird to me that they'd sign him to the active (guaranteeing his money) when he'd been unsigned to that point.

That's what teams usually do with veteran players that haven't been in camp. Put them on the PS until they're up to game speed. If he wanted to sign somewhere else, he'd have done it by now. The money doesn't matter to him because in all probability there's offset language in his contract where anything he earns this year just off-sets the Pats money.

Signing him straight to the active didn't make a lot of sense to me.

So maybe they gave him a camp invite w/ an understanding that they'd sign him to the PS when it opens?
